Initiatives and Impact

1. Advancing Education Across Sindh

  • Academic Excellence: APWA schools maintained high performance in board exams and continuous assessments.

  • Increased Admissions: Rising enrollment demonstrates community trust in APWA’s educational programs.

  • Faculty Development: Professional development workshops enhanced teaching methodologies and school leadership.

  • Student Engagement: Participation in extracurricular competitions fosters leadership, confidence, and holistic development.

2. Women’s Empowerment and Skill Development

  • Vocational Training: Courses in entrepreneurship, handicrafts, and digital literacy empower women financially.

  • Workshops & Awareness Programs: Sessions on gender equality, leadership, and financial literacy broaden women’s societal roles and capabilities.

3. Maternal and Child Healthcare

  • Expanded Services: Maternity homes in Khairpur provide prenatal, postnatal, and reproductive healthcare to hundreds of women.

  • Donor Partnerships: Collaborations with organizations like Mama Baby Fund distribute newborn care packages and essential medical supplies.

  • Health Awareness Campaigns: Regular camps educate women on reproductive health, maternal care, and infant wellness.

District Reports

Sukkur: Excellence in Education & Leadership

  • 35 students achieved A1 grades and 34 students earned A grades in B.I.S.E Sukkur SSC II exams.

  • Increased student admissions and active participation in inter-school competitions reflect academic quality and trust.

  • Faculty attended workshops by AFAQ and Lightstone Education for modern classroom strategies, leadership training, and innovative pedagogy.

​

Hyderabad: Strengthening Education & Infrastructure

  • Maintains high-quality English-medium education and discipline-driven learning.

  • Exploring expansion by utilizing a vacant hall for a student activity center, auditorium, or library expansion.

  • Digital learning and modern teaching tools are being integrated to enhance student outcomes.

​

Khairpur: Advancing Maternal & Child Healthcare

  • APWA Maternity Home handles 50–60 childbirth cases monthly, providing critical care for expectant mothers and newborns.

  • Partnerships with donors provide 200+ newborn care packages annually.

  • Future plans include acquiring modern medical equipment, expanding awareness programs, and transforming ‘Kak Mehal’ property into a multi-purpose healthcare center.
